当前位置: 首页 > 数据中台  > 数据可视化平台

数据可视化图表与试用工具的技术探索

本文探讨了数据可视化图表在计算机领域的应用,重点分析了试用功能的实现方式及其实用价值。

随着大数据和人工智能技术的快速发展,数据可视化图表已经成为现代信息系统中不可或缺的一部分。它不仅能够帮助用户更直观地理解复杂的数据关系,还能提升决策效率。在实际开发过程中,许多开发者和企业会通过“试用”功能来评估不同的数据可视化工具是否符合自身需求。本文将围绕“数据可视化图表”和“试用”这两个关键词,深入探讨其在计算机技术中的应用、实现方式以及相关工具的试用策略。

一、数据可视化图表的核心概念

数据可视化是指将数据以图形或图像的形式展示出来,使得信息更加直观和易于理解。常见的数据可视化图表包括柱状图、折线图、饼图、散点图、热力图等。这些图表类型各有特点,适用于不同的数据场景和分析需求。

在计算机科学领域,数据可视化图表通常依赖于前端框架(如D3.js、ECharts、Chart.js)或后端数据处理引擎(如Python的Matplotlib、Seaborn)。它们通过API接口或数据绑定的方式,将原始数据转换为可交互的图表形式,从而提高数据分析的效率和准确性。

二、试用功能的必要性与应用场景

在软件开发和产品设计中,“试用”功能是一个非常重要的环节。对于数据可视化工具而言,试用功能允许用户在不购买或部署完整系统的情况下,体验其核心功能和使用流程。这种机制不仅有助于降低用户的决策成本,还能提升产品的市场接受度。

试用功能可以分为几种类型:例如,临时试用(限时可用)、功能限制试用(仅开放部分功能)、沙盒环境试用(模拟真实数据进行测试)等。不同的试用模式适用于不同的用户群体和产品定位。

在数据可视化工具的试用过程中,用户可以通过上传自己的数据集,查看图表生成效果,测试不同图表类型的适配性,并评估工具的性能表现。这种体验式学习方式,能够帮助用户更好地了解工具的功能边界和适用范围。

三、数据可视化图表的技术实现

数据可视化图表的实现涉及多个技术层面,包括数据处理、图表渲染、交互设计等。

首先,在数据处理阶段,原始数据需要经过清洗、转换和聚合,以便适应图表的显示需求。例如,时间序列数据可能需要按天、周或月进行分组;分类数据可能需要统计每个类别的频率。

其次,在图表渲染方面,现代数据可视化工具通常采用基于Web的渲染技术,如SVG(可缩放矢量图形)或Canvas(画布)。这些技术能够支持动态更新、动画效果和高分辨率显示,满足不同设备和屏幕尺寸的需求。

最后,交互设计是提升用户体验的关键因素。良好的交互功能包括图表缩放、数据筛选、动态刷新、图例控制等。这些功能通过JavaScript事件监听和DOM操作实现,使用户能够更灵活地探索数据。

四、试用功能的技术实现方式

为了提供有效的试用体验,数据可视化工具通常需要构建一个轻量级的试用环境,该环境具备基本的功能模块,同时避免对用户造成过高的资源消耗。

一种常见的做法是使用容器化技术(如Docker)创建独立的试用实例,确保用户在试用过程中不会影响到生产环境。此外,还可以利用云服务(如AWS、Azure、阿里云)快速搭建试用平台,提供弹性计算资源。

在代码层面,试用功能通常通过权限控制和功能限制来实现。例如,试用版可能只允许用户使用有限数量的图表类型,或者限制数据导入的大小和格式。这些限制可以通过后端逻辑或前端验证来实现。

另外,为了提升用户体验,一些工具还提供了“一键试用”或“在线演示”功能。用户无需注册即可直接访问试用页面,体验完整的图表生成和交互功能。这种模式特别适合面向开发者和技术人员的产品推广。

五、试用功能的优化与挑战

尽管试用功能在数据可视化工具中具有重要作用,但在实际实施过程中也面临诸多挑战。

首先,性能问题是试用环境中最常见的问题之一。由于试用版通常不提供完整的服务器资源,可能导致图表加载缓慢、响应延迟等问题。因此,优化代码结构、减少冗余计算、采用异步加载等方式,是提升试用体验的关键。

其次,安全性和数据隐私也是试用功能需要考虑的重要因素。用户在试用过程中可能会上传敏感数据,因此工具应提供数据加密、访问控制和日志审计等功能,以保障用户数据的安全。

此外,试用功能的设计也需要兼顾易用性和功能性。过于复杂的试用流程可能会降低用户参与度,而功能过于简单则无法体现工具的真实价值。因此,合理规划试用流程和功能模块,是提升用户满意度的重要手段。

六、未来趋势与展望

随着人工智能和机器学习技术的不断进步,数据可视化工具正在向智能化方向发展。未来的数据可视化系统可能具备自动选择最佳图表类型、智能推荐分析维度、自动生成报告等功能。

数据可视化

与此同时,试用功能也将更加智能化和个性化。例如,基于用户行为数据的推荐试用方案,可以根据用户的历史操作和偏好,动态调整试用内容和功能范围。这种个性化的试用体验,将极大提升用户对工具的认同感和使用意愿。

此外,随着开源生态的繁荣,越来越多的数据可视化工具开始采用开源模式,提供免费的试用版本。这不仅降低了用户的试用门槛,也为开发者提供了更多的学习和实践机会。

七、结语

数据可视化图表作为现代信息技术的重要组成部分,正日益受到重视。而试用功能则是用户了解和评估工具的重要途径。通过合理的试用设计和技术实现,不仅可以提升用户体验,还能促进工具的广泛应用和发展。

在未来,随着技术的不断进步和用户需求的多样化,数据可视化工具和试用功能将继续演进,为用户提供更加高效、智能和便捷的数据分析体验。

*以上内容来源于互联网,如不慎侵权,联系必删!

相关资讯

    暂无相关的数据...